January 11, 2020Fine Flint prints now on display
The special Prints in the Gallery exhibits from 12 January till 12 February contains two major prints from Sir William Russell Flint that are now on display. Left to right they are, Slipway, Devonport Shipyard and Gossipers at La Castellet. The former, painted in 1943 was bombed by the Nazi's two days after Flint had completed this composition. This print represents that last illustration of the shipyard structure....

December 9, 2019This is what we do
We are extremely pleased that we are able to support the Waitomo/Waipa Women’s Refuge services. The refuge runs two safe houses for women and children victims of domestic violence in the Waikato region. The funds donated will help children, including special needs children, who require services in the form of counselling and play therapy programmes. September 27, 2019Feature of the month for October 2019
This is one of only two known art deco handkerchiefs that were given to attendees at the world premiere of Gone with the Wind, 15th December 1939 at the Loew’s Grand Theatre in Atlanta. Reputedly over 300,000 people lined the streets as limousines brought the stars to the theatre. This followed three days of festivities with the actual release date of 15 December declared a Georgian State holiday.
